Find the top Steak houses in Omaha, Nebraska near you now.
Restaurant
Address: 16920 Wright Plaza #118, Omaha, NE 68130
Italian restaurant
Address: 3125 S 72nd St, Omaha, NE 68124
Steak house
Address: 1010 Capitol Ave, Omaha, NE 68102
Address: 1620 S 10th St, Omaha, NE 68108
Address: 7605 Cass St, Omaha, NE 68114
Address: 222 S 15th St Ste 152 S, Omaha, NE 68102
Address: 1110 Capitol Ave, Omaha, NE 68102
Buffet restaurant
Address: 6006 N 72nd St, Omaha, NE 68134
Address: 7425 Dodge St #103, Omaha, NE 68114
Address: 4917 Center St, Omaha, NE 68106
Address: 8702 Pacific St, Omaha, NE 68114
Address: 13208 W Maple Rd, Omaha, NE 68164
Fine dining restaurant
Address: 140 Regency Pkwy, Omaha, NE 68114
Address: 2414 S 132nd St, Omaha, NE 68144
Address: 3040 S 143rd Plaza, Omaha, NE 68144
Japanese restaurant
Address: 14505 W Center Rd, Omaha, NE 68144
Address: 1350 S 119th St, Omaha, NE 68144
Address: 17415 Chicago St, Omaha, NE 68118
Address: 305 N 170th St, Omaha, NE 68118
Address: 520 N 155th Plaza, Omaha, NE 68154